A woman who is a sickle cell anemia "carrier" (heterozygous genotype) marries a man who has sickle cell anemia (homozygous recessive genotype). What are the odds that their first child will have sickle cell anemia? 75% 0% 50% 100% 25%

The woman is a carrier, which means her genotype is Hs (H for normal hemoglobin and s for sickle cell hemoglobin). Show more…
